`

判断一个字符串是否存在于一个字符串数组中

 
阅读更多

[代码]方法一:

string[] array = { "1", "2", "3" };
List<string> list = new List<string>(array); 
if(list.Contains("1"))
{
   //字符串"1"存在
}
else
{
   //字符串"1"不存在
}



[代码]方法二:

string[] array = {"1" ,"2" ,"3" };
int id = Array.IndexOf(array,"1"); 
if(id==-1)
{
    //字符串"1"不存在
}
else
{
    //字符串"1"存在
}

 骇客资讯

分享到:
评论

相关推荐

    C#判断一个字符是否在字符串里/数组里

    在C#编程语言中,判断一个字符是否存在于字符串或数组中是常见的操作,这在处理文本数据时尤其重要。下面我们将详细探讨如何实现这个功能,以及相关的重要知识点。 首先,我们要知道C#提供了多种方法来检查字符是否...

    MATLAB代码示例,用于将一个字符串添加到字符串数组的末尾(附详细步骤).txt

    % 检查新字符串是否已经存在于字符串数组中 if ~ismember(newStr, strArray) % 如果新字符串不存在于字符串数组中,则使用[]将其添加到末尾 strArray = [strArray, newStr]; else % 如果新字符串已经存在于字符串...

    怎样判断一个字符串在一个LISTBOX中是否存在

    ### 二、如何判断字符串是否存在于ListBox中 #### 2.1 使用 Items.IndexOf 方法 在Delphi中,ListBox有一个名为Items的属性,该属性实际上是一个StringList对象。StringList对象提供了一个名为IndexOf的方法,可以...

    Java 生成随机字符串数组的实例详解

    下面是一个详细的实例详解,介绍了生成随机字符串数组的步骤和相关知识点。 知识点1:String String是Java中的一种基本数据类型,用于表示字符串。String类提供了许多有用的方法,例如substring()、indexOf()、...

    Java检索字符串中是否存在某字符

    这是指KMP算法的主要应用,即判断一个给定的子串是否是主字符串的子序列。通过遍历主字符串和子串,如果可以顺利完成匹配,那么子串就在主字符串中;反之,不在。 4. 描述中的"2是检索出现几次": 如果我们要统计...

    Labview-比较两个字符串,显示相同字符个数

    Labview-比较两个字符串,显示相同字符个数

    ORACLE存储过程中定义数组并且判断某值是否在数组中.txt

    ORACLE存储过程中定义数组并且判断某值是否在数组中。有例子可執行、 、有例子可執行、

    判断字符串是否为空

    `nil`和`NSNull`也是判断字符串是否为空时需要注意的特殊情况。在Objective-C中,`nil`表示对象不存在,而`NSNull`则常用于表示“无值”或“空值”。对于`nil`字符串,`length`方法会返回0,而`isEqualToString:`会...

    js遍历数组、判断是否存在字符串.xlsm

    js遍历数组、判断是否存在字符串.xlsm

    matlab数组字符串

    - `isstr(a)`判断变量a是否为字符串。 - `isletter(a)`检测字符串中每个字符是否为英文字母。 - `isspace(a)`检查字符串中的字符是否为空格、回车、制表或换行符。 - `isstrprop(a,'category')`检测字符串中每个字符...

    LabView(7.1)清除字符串中相同的字符

    1. **字符串数组**:LabView中的字符串通常以数组的形式存在,尤其是当我们需要处理多个字符串或者遍历字符串的每个字符时。在这个案例中,数组可能包含输入字符串。 2. **For循环**:为了遍历字符串并检查重复字符...

    js判断数组是否相等的方法

    在JavaScript中,判断两个数组是否相等是一个常见的需求,尤其在处理数据比较或者验证时。根据标题和描述,我们可以区分两种不同的场景: 1. **数组完全相等**:在这种情况下,不仅要求数组中的元素相同,而且元素...

    C 语言 指针实现 字符串是否为回文

    本程序的主要目的是判断一个给定的字符串是否为回文。为了实现这一功能,采用的方法是从字符串的两端同时向中间移动两个指针,逐一比较对应位置的字符是否相同。如果在整个过程中没有发现不同的字符,则该字符串是...

    js判断数组是否包含某个字符串变量的实例

    在JavaScript中,判断一个数组是否包含某个特定的字符串变量是一个常见的操作,这对于数据处理和渲染非常关键。以下将详细解说如何使用JavaScript进行这类判断,并结合实例进行说明。 ### 知识点一:使用indexOf...

    理解java中的字符串的内存分配

    如果不存在,则会在字符串常量池中创建一个新的 `"abc"` 字符串。之后,将在堆内存中创建一个新的字符串对象 `A`,并使用 `s1` 引用指向这个对象。 再看另一个示例: ```java String s2 = "abc"; ``` 这里,由于 ...

    matlab数组字符串 删除字符+比较字符数组和字符串 算法开发、数据可视化、数据分析以及数值计算 Matlab课程教程 进阶

    例如,在信息检索系统中,删除停用词(如“的”、“和”等)就是一个典型的字符删除操作,而比较字符数组和字符串可以帮助我们确定文档之间的关联性。 “数据可视化”领域,处理字符串数据同样重要。比如,当你的...

    数据结构有关字符串数组的详细解答课件

    例如,字符串类可能有一个构造函数用于初始化字符串,一个`length()`方法返回字符串的长度,`equals()`方法用于判断字符串是否相等,以及`substring()`方法用于提取子串。 此外,对于大量稀疏数据的处理,我们会...

    php判断数组元素中是否存在某个字符串的方法

    在PHP编程中,判断数组元素中是否存在某个字符串是常见的需求,这有助于我们处理和过滤数据。以下是三种常用的方法,以及它们的特点和适用场景。 **方法一:`in_array()`** `in_array()` 函数用于检查数组中是否...

    CheckUnique_labview_字符串处理_

    标题"CheckUnique_labview_字符串处理_"指的是一个专门用于检查字符串数组中元素唯一性的功能。这个功能可以帮助开发者确保数据的准确性和完整性,尤其在数据处理、数据分析或者数据输入验证等场景中。 描述中提到...

Global site tag (gtag.js) - Google Analytics